Food Safety Report: KFC/Taco Bell,9619 Sheep Creek Rd, Phelan, CA 92371, USA.

3 years ago source sbsun.com business

9619 Sheep Creek Road, Phelan, 92371 California, United States

Closure date: 02/01/2022

Rodent infestation, no hot water. The inspector didn’t note any roaches or other bugs but did find fresh and dry rodent droppings in a number of locations, including under the fryer, under racks where clean utensils are stored and in the dining area. Also, the restaurant didn’t have hot water; the owner said the water heater was in disrepair. There was one other critical violation, for several large cans of oyster sauce having severe dents on the seams, and 11 lesser violations.
